Garmin Fenix 8 Public Beta 13.22
Garmin is rolling out Public Beta 13.22 for the Fenix 8 Series
Supported Models:
- Fenix 8 AMOLED: 43mm, 47mm, 51mm
- Fenix 8 Solar: 47mm, 51mm
- Enduro 3
- Fenix E
Update Overview:
- This Beta update is available “Over The Air” (OTA)
- Public Beta Users: Updates will arrive within 24–48 hours for those in the target rollout percentage. You can also manually request the update:
- On your watch: Menu > System > Software Update > Check for Updates.
- This option works even if you’re outside the target rollout percentage.

Important Notes
ECG and Dive Features:
- These features are disabled in Beta software for the Fenix 8 series.
- To retain these features, avoid joining the Public Beta program.
- If Beta software is installed, you can backdate to Live software to re-enable these features.
- After backdating, ECG setup is required. More information: ECG App Setup.
- ECG and Dive features will return in Beta updates nearing Live status and remain in Live software updates.
RAM File Saving:
This update modifies how RAM files are saved after crashes. Refer to the What to do after a freeze or crash wiki page for details.
Change log for version 13.22 (changes since v13.21, previous beta release):
- Added Passcode Support: when enabled for extra security, you will be prompted to enter your PIN to regain access to your watch after it was taken off your wrist.
- Added Solar Intensity and Accumulation Data Fields (Solar models only).
- Added Haptic Vibration to Number Pad Pages.
- Added Hint Button to Training Load Ratio Page.
- Added Swedish and Danish Layouts to the QWERTY Keyboard.
- Fixed Contact List in Large Font Mode.
- Fixed Delayed Flashlight Active App Icon.
- Fixed Incorrect Speed/Cadence Sensor Icon.
- Fixed Map App to Allow Round-Trip Course Navigation.
- Fixed QWERTY Keyboard Shift State on Password Entry.
- Improved Stage Cards to Display Pressed State.
Changelog for Version 13.18 (Since v13.14)
New Features:
- Character pop-up added when typing on the QWERTY keyboard.
- Font scaling support added to workout structure cards.
- Proximity alert option added to all GPS activities.
- Segments added to the Training menu.
- Transparency added to the pan/zoom bar on maps.
Fixes:
- “Until Sunrise” flashlight strobe tip now displays correctly.
- Fixed accidental alarm dismissals via touch screen.
- Resolved broken “Delete” option for custom activity profiles.
- Cycling ability page now matches the Fenix 7 UI.
- Fixed dynamic source switching settings failures.
- Corrected event countdown page to include locations.
- Improved layout of the daily suggested workout list.
- Map app now uses correct touchscreen settings.
- Fixed multi-sensor pairing issues.
- Corrected notification centre’s initial item selection.
- Fixed potential crash when leaving meditation activities.
- Resolved ski difficulty screen showing incorrect run data.
- Smart notifications no longer display blank pages.
- Fixed swipe-to-exit functionality for panning charts.
- Weight now appears correctly on the strength workout next step page.
Improvements:
- Enhanced RAM file saving.
Removed:
- Extraneous power controls (Enduro 3 and Fenix E only).
Updates:
- Refined recent sleep scores page.
